Interactive Health, the country’s leading provider of health management solutions, creates innovative wellness programs designed to increase overall company health and actively engage employees to make lasting behavior changes. For every company’s perspective on health management, early stage or mature, Interactive Health has a highly flexible program to meet its needs. By offering health evaluations that detect risk proactively, Interactive Health has the capability to immediately intervene and engage at-risk participants with a personalized course of action. Using ActiveEngine(TM), a proprietary algorithmic-based clinical intelligence engine, a unique achievable goal is assigned to each participant based on individual results and health improvements are measured. Interactive Health has a 20+ year track record of creating the Healthiest Companies in America.
Sidney Regional Medical Center (SRMC) is a 25-bed, non-profit CAH designated healthcare facility. SRMC is committed to providing high-quality compassionate care by offering a wide array of services and surgeries. SRMC has been a part of the community since 1955.
PaxeraHealth (Formerly Paxeramed) is a leading healthcare solution developer based in Boston, MA. We develop a full range of medical imaging solutions including PACS, RIS, VNA, multi-modality workstations, mobile App viewers, patient portal, dental PACS, Vet PACS, advanced visualization, Patient engagement and enterprise solutions. Leveraging technology and staying at the forefront of new healthcare IT technological developments is a high priority for PaxeraHealth. The company develops the next generation medical imaging and Patient engagement technologies designed to automate clients` workflow, elevate patient care and cut healthcare costs.
